No such equivalent logic exists in the IPv4 stack, and it turns out that this leads to us dropping valid traffic when the "point to point" interface is actually a 1:many tun interface, e.g. with the wireguard userland stack. Even in the case of true point-to-point links, this logic only avoids transient looping of packets sent by misconfigured applications or attackers, which can be subverted by proper route configuration rather than hardcoded logic in the kernel to drop packets. In the review, melifaro goes on to note that the kernel can't fix it, so it perhaps shouldn't try to be 'smart' about it. Additionally, that TTL will still kick in even with incorrect route configuration.
